Francis James LONERGAN

aka ” Frank “

New South Wales Police Force

Regd. #  8527

Rank:  Sergeant 2nd Class – Retired 1988

Stations:  Bass Hill, Bankstown ( 1972 ), Campsie

Service:  From 1957 ? to 1988

Awards?

Born:  15 February 1933

Died on: 5 February 2011

Cause:  Cancer

Age:  78

Funeral date:  10 February 2011

Funeral location:  Catholic Cemeteries & Crematoria – Rookwood Cemetery

Buried at:  Lawn-St John of God Lawn– Section: LWN*STJOHN***1439

[alert_blue]FRANK is NOT mentioned on the Police Wall of Remembrance[/alert_blue]  * NOT JOB RELATED

FRANK LONERGAN - Died of cancer in 2011 NSWPF
Sergeant Frank Lonergan

 

 

Frank served in various locations with the New South Wales Police Force; locations such as Bankstown around 1971 / 1972.
